I hooked up my Asus H110I-Plus with a MZHOU SATA Erweiterungskarte 6 port  (https://www.amazon.de/gp/product/B09F2TCD5C/ref=ppx_yo_dt_b_search_asin_title?ie=UTF8&language=en_GB&th=1) and rum try too run 9 Disk´s. 3 Sata SSD´s Samsung EVO serie intern and 6 HDD´s 3,5 zoll on the expension card . butt my computer can only find 4x HDD off the expensions card all drives working. but as soon i deplug 1 HDD i find another that was before unfund. Is there a bottleneck with the chip or anyway that i can use all 9 drives?

That controller card is kinda crap.  It has a 2 port sata controller (ASM1061 chip) and then a second chip JMB575 is used as port multiplier .. the port multiplier chip is like a network switch  - it takes signals from up to 6 sata devices and mixes them into a single sata output (so those 5 devices in total share a 600 MB/s channel)

 

So you may have on that card: 


ASM1061 port 1-----> SATA PORT 1

ASM1061 port 2 ----->  JMB575 ---- >  5 sata connectors:  SATA PORT 2  ... SATA PORT 6

 

I don't know what to tell you, if I were to make an educated guess, I would say one drive doesn't like port multipliers and then you can't use those with sata ports created by port multiplier chips

New? probably not.

Used / refurbished plenty of them ...  but prices went up for a while because of all the Chia mining craze... I think they're coming down. 

 

Look on eBay for  keywords like:  sas controller  hba jbod 

 

sas cards have 1 or 2 connectors in which you can plug a cable with 4 sata ports  .. so a 2 port SAS controller can do 8 sata drives. 

hba = controller without raid featured 

jbod  = just bunch of disks  - again no raid features 

 

The SAS connectors are called SFF8087 so you can search for  SFF8087 to SATA cable    (or use words breakout cable etc)

ok then i need too go this way i have a raid card IBM M5015 / LSI Megaraid SAS 9260-8i SATA / SAS Controller  but mine has only raid support

The 9260 controller does NOT support standalone drives, the drives must be in a RAID configuration to work. So it's not recommended. 

 

9211 will be most compatible with everything
